Model: CPE710  
Hardware Version: V1
Firmware Version: CPE710(UN)_V1_20211216

Can the CPE710 connect to a third-party (ex. Buffalo) 5 GHz AP ?

Or is it only possible to connect CPE710 each other?

Yes, you can use the CPE to recieve the wifi signal from third-part AP, but note wireless communication is bidirectional.

So you need to make sure the AP can send the signal in such a long distance.
